current events. John William Ferrell (/ ˈfɛrəl /; [ 1 ] born July 16, 1967) [ 2 ][ 3 ] is an American actor, comedian, writer, and producer. He is known for his leading man roles in comedy films and for his work as a television producer. Ferrell has earned six Emmy Awards and in 2011 was honored with the Mark Twain Prize for American Humor.

John William Ferrell was born July 16th, 1967 in Irvine, California. Following university, he joined The Groundlings improv troupe in the early 1990s. After an audition where he parodied Chicago Cubs announcer Harry Caray, Senator Ted Kennedy and a cat, Ferrell joined the cast of the sketch comedy show “Saturday Night Live” in 1995.
John William Ferrell was born on July 16, 1967, in Irvine, California, USA. His father Roy Lee Ferrell Junior was a keyboard player with ‘The Righteous Brothers’ and his mother Betty Kay (née Overman) was a teacher. Will has a younger brother named Patrick. When Will was eight years old, his parents divorced.
